Can someone tell me how to send money for postage using Paypal? Sandi
Using Paypal
Log into your PayPal account. Click on "Send Money" at the top. Enter the amount and the email address of the recipient.

Thanks Patrob, but I don't have Paypal acct. do I have to have an acct in order to send money to someone else?
Yes, but it is easy to set up and free to you when you send money. They will require an email address and either a checking account or a credit card number. Their web site www.paypal.com will take you thru the sign up process step by step. The money is transmitted by an email address.

I have had good luck with PayPal, but you really have to watch out for the "Phishing" emails you get from criminals who have their emails set up to look exactly like they are coming from PayPal. They usually say they are confirming a payment sent to someone for an EBay auction, and if you are disputing this please click on a link they include.
Since Paypal always really sends a confirmatory email about payments, you have to really look closely. The "sender" info on the fake ones looks the same, the email itself looks just like it is coming from PayPal.The real emails don't have a "Link" to dispute payments.
I've never clicked on the false link, but would imagine it would ask you what your log in and password were for paypal, then the criminals would have your information and could clean you out. I have my account set up with a checking account that only has a small amount of money in at any one time and a credit card that I only use for online purchases. just have to be really careful and always type in the address and open a web page for yourself, not through a link.nancy
